IranÕs nuclear program began under Shah Mohammed Reza Pahlavi its founder was Akbar Etemad a physicist who led the Atomic Energy Organization of Iran from 1974 to 1979 He was forced into exile as the new Islamic egime came to power in 1979 because the countryÕs new leaders believed that the nu ID: 831632
